I think if we look at the longterm track results posted by mthis and dodger we can see this is not a one time anomoly.
Back on 10/20/10 at MIR in -300 to +200' DA dodger ran a best ET of 11.23 and best trap of 125.66 with several other 11.3@124.5+ runs.
mthis at the same event went 11.38.
Then on 11/22/10 at ATCO with DA in the -200 to +300' range dodger ran 17 passes, none slower than 11.38 with a best of 11.21 with traps ranging from 124-125.5mph. mthis ran another 11.38@123.5mph.
Today in -1500' (approximately I haven't checked myself just going off what was posted in the other thread) DA they ran 10.99 and 11.19 with traps in the 125-127 range.
So again when looking at the big picture today was literally the first day they had their cars in great air, and the gains are exactly on par with what the changes in DA show.
Again Great job to everyone today!
